Transaction 3aa86923c16183150502f95ecfd51a4cf8ce451b371a18fde9e05716360d6844

1 Input
2 Outputs
  • 3aa86923c16183150502f95ecfd51a4cf8ce451b371a18fde9e05716360d6844:0
  • value  191479
    address  1KR8qW5Uij6zVjHAbFkAkfMWg6idkYzQpr
  • 3aa86923c16183150502f95ecfd51a4cf8ce451b371a18fde9e05716360d6844:1
  • value  420000
    address  1P5XuULDcEH7PLFJkyDTqEGfLLeypcDEyP